Understanding Floating Solar Farms

Floating solar farms, also referred to as floating photovoltaic (FPV) systems, are essentially solar arrays that are anchored to the surface of bodies of water. This innovative method offers several benefits, including the mitigation of land competition, which is a pressing issue in many regions where land for renewable energy projects is scarce. The cooling effects of the water can lead to improved solar panel efficiency, further boosting energy production. Additionally, these installations help to minimize water evaporation from reservoirs, thereby contributing to water conservation efforts, particularly in arid regions.

Key Projects Paving the Way

The implementation of floating solar farms is already underway across various states, with several noteworthy projects highlighting their potential. In California, utilities are investing in floating solar technology on reservoirs to help meet the state’s ambitious clean energy targets. Additionally, in the Midwest, smaller installations on rural waterways are providing essential power to local communities and their irrigation systems. Coastal states like Florida and Texas have also initiated pilot projects that focus on developing solar arrays robust enough to withstand the challenges presented by saltwater environments.

Environmental and Energy-Efficiency Advantages

One of the most compelling reasons for adopting floating solar technology is its energy generation efficiency. Research indicates that floating solar farms can produce more energy per panel due to the cooling effect of the water, which helps to maintain optimal operating temperatures. Importantly, these solar farms do not occupy valuable agricultural or urban land, thereby preserving it for other uses. Furthermore, by reducing water evaporation from reservoirs, floating solar systems can bolster water resource management, which is critical in regions facing water scarcity.

Challenges to Overcome

While the prospects for floating solar farms are promising, several challenges remain. One of the primary hurdles is the higher installation costs associated with these systems compared to traditional land-based solar farms. Additionally, floating solar installations often require specialized maintenance due to their location and exposure to varied water conditions. However, advancements in technology have begun to lower these costs, and federal incentives are promoting the adoption of floating solar farms by making investments more financially viable for many stakeholders.
